Many of you know K.O. and Kina. K.O will be 5 in March and Kina will be 2 in February. Kina has to be with K.O., in his presence, otherwise she becomes very anxious. K.O. is a bit more aloof about it but you can see when I return Kina to him after a walk, he checks her out and is happy and playful with her. I've noticed over the last several months, that if I take Kina out first for a "nature" break and then take K.O. out... he then sniffs out from a distance and tracks down where she went pee and poop (we have to pick it up in bags by village ordinance) which can be in a lot of different directions and then he covers it with his pee.

I've never heard of this before but K.O. is consistently and intentionally covering her urine and fecal scent, with his urine scent.

Is this a message to other male dogs, that Kina is "his"?

Along this same line of possession and dominance, I've also noticed that if I am having fun with Kina and get a bit aggressive with her in our play together, K.O. gets upset and comes to me and challenges me that I'm going a bit too far for his comfort and does not want me to get any more aggressive with her.

Interesting behavior and dynamics.

Any thoughts on all of this?
